    Platte River Run - Larry MacTaggart

    Commissioned by the Fremont, Nebraska High School Band, this work is subtitled: "A Nebraska Overture." It is a descriptive work depicting the Platte River from its quiet origins in the Rocky Mountains in Colorado, which then winds across the rolling Nebraska landscape. There is a spirited pioneer theme depicting the courageous Americans who 150 years ago paved the way west by blazing the Oregon and Mormon Trails along the Platte River.

    The River and the Rock (The Tale of a City) (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Shaffer, David

    The River and the Rock depicts the rich history of Fitchburg, Massachusetts, settled in 1735. Each short movement paints a musical picture of the city's history, opening with "Beginnings," depicting a frontier that was settled very slowly as hostilities between England and France encouraged Indian bounty hunters to attack isolated garrisons in the region. "Patriots" suggests the city's call to arms throughout history. "Prosperity" visits the industrial revolution and the city's rapid growth at the turn of the 20th century. Movement IV and V, "Decline" and "Revival," offer a musical insight into the city's decline throughout the 20th century and rebirth in the 21st century.
